Climbinglimit.com, an online platform, is involved in a deceptive scam by operating a counterfeit store. The scam surfaced barely three months after the website’s inception. The products marketed on this site are replicas, possibly hazardous due to the low-quality materials used during their production. Several indicators hint that the site’s activities spring from China. Surprisingly, the business address provided on the website turns out to be nonexistent. Furthermore, the content on this website echoes that of similar platforms, suggesting a case of content replication.

A fake store scam involves a fraudulent online platform posing as a legitimate store, usually selling counterfeit or non-existent products. The scammer usually aims to deceive unsuspecting customers into making purchases, after which they disappear without delivering the promised items.

A fake store scam is a fraudulent scheme. Scammers set up a phony online store. They advertise products at unbeatably low prices. The scammer's goal is to lure in unsuspecting shoppers. These fake stores often mimic well-known brands. They use a similar name or logo to deceive people. The sites may look professional and legitimate. They promise high-quality products and great customer service. Scammers use various tactics to trick people. They may send spam emails or run ads on social media. They use these methods to direct potential victims to their fake online store. Once a purchase is made, the scammer takes the payment. But they never send the product. The buyer is left with no product and a lighter wallet. The scammer then disappears, often closing the fake store and starting a new one.
